X-Men Extra #1
In "Perdus de vue," the X-Men and the Acolytes crash-land and struggle to regroup in the aftermath of a mysterious disaster. With chaos unfolding, Callisto tracks down Colossus, appealing to him for help in a mission that could change everything. Written by Fabian Nicieza and Nicole Duclos, with dynamic art by Andy Kubert and cover by Andy Kubert and Cam Smith, this 1997 issue delivers a tense, character-driven moment in the mutant saga.
In the wreckage of a fallen battle, the X-Men and Acolytes struggle to regroup amidst chaos. Callisto, ever pragmatic, tracks down Colossus with a desperate plea—his strength and resolve may be the key to preventing a greater disaster.
In "Les nuits de Fatalis," the enigmatic Doctor Tinner grapples with a relentless nightmare that refuses to leave him in peace. With the help of unlikely allies—Wolverine and Ghost Rider—he attempts to master the dark forces haunting his dreams, but the line between reality and the subconscious begins to blur.
